Breaking down the question
The instruction is to write a note on the uneven impact of the Green Revolution on rural society. The controlling word is "uneven" — the examiner does not want a general account of the Green Revolution but an analysis of how its benefits and costs were distributed unequally across regions, classes, castes and crops.
The Green Revolution, from the mid-1960s, introduced high-yielding seed varieties, chemical fertilisers, assured irrigation and mechanisation. It raised food-grain output dramatically and averted famine. Your task is to show that this technological package, applied within an unequal agrarian structure, tended to widen rather than narrow existing disparities.

Model answer
The Green Revolution was a strategy of agricultural modernisation that combined high-yielding varieties of seed, chemical fertilisers, pesticides, assured irrigation and mechanisation to raise food-grain production. It succeeded spectacularly in lifting output and securing the nation against famine. Yet because this technological package was capital-intensive and was introduced into an already unequal agrarian structure, its impact on rural society was profoundly uneven.
Regional unevenness. The new technology depended on assured irrigation, and so its gains concentrated in a few well-endowed regions — Punjab, Haryana and western Uttar Pradesh — while vast rain-fed and eastern tracts were largely bypassed. This sharpened regional inequality, producing prosperous agrarian belts alongside stagnant ones and widening inter-regional disparities in income and development.
Class unevenness. The package favoured those who could afford seeds, fertiliser, tubewells and machinery. Large and medium landowners captured most of the gains, while small and marginal farmers, lacking capital and credit, benefited little and sometimes lost ground as costs rose. Rising land values and profitability encouraged owners to resume land for self-cultivation, displacing tenants. The result, as Utsa Patnaik argued, was the growth of a class of capitalist farmers producing for the market and employing wage labour — a deepening of agrarian differentiation.
The condition of labour. Mechanisation and the substitution of machines for manual operations displaced agricultural labourers in some tasks even as commercial cultivation raised demand in others. Wages rose in pockets, but the bargaining position of the landless remained weak, and the widening gap between prosperous farmers and labourers heightened rural tension. Francine Frankel warned that this uneven prosperity carried real political risks of unrest.
Caste dimension. Because landownership in India is patterned by caste, the class gains of the Green Revolution largely accrued to dominant landowning castes, while Dalit and lower-caste labourers remained propertyless. The technology thus reinforced the class-caste nexus that Andre Beteille identified at the heart of agrarian stratification, translating economic advantage into consolidated social and political power for the dominant peasantry.
Crop and ecological unevenness. The revolution was confined largely to wheat and rice, neglecting pulses, coarse grains and dryland crops on which the poor depend. Over time, intensive input use brought ecological costs — falling water tables, soil degradation and rising indebtedness from expensive inputs — burdens borne disproportionately by smaller cultivators.
A dynamic but unequal transformation. The Green Revolution did modernise agriculture and created a confident, market-oriented farming class that later became a powerful political force through farmers' movements. But this very success was selective. It raised aggregate production while concentrating gains, so that the countryside became more, not less, differentiated.
In sum, the Green Revolution's impact was uneven along every major axis — region, class, caste, crop and ecology. By grafting a capital-intensive technology onto an unequal structure, it boosted output and food security yet widened the distances within rural society, confirming that technological change is refracted through, and tends to reproduce, existing social inequalities.
